2. Solution concepts and algorithms
Stochastic VRPs can be cast within the framework of stochastic programming. Stochastic programs are modeled in two stages. In a first stage, a planned or "a priori" solution is determined. The realizations of the random variables are then disclosed and, in a second stage, a recourse or corrective action is then applied to the first stage solution. The recourse usually.generates a cost or a saving that may have to be considered when designing the first stage solution.